Volunteer Opportunities
If you are sincerely interested in inspiring, motivating, and impacting young lives, then Boys & Girls Clubs is the place for you! Depending on the specific club location, we offer volunteer opportunities in the areas of tutoring, mentoring, coaching, special events, programming assistance, administrative support, and more. We are currently seeking volunteers for our summer camp session which runs June 7th – July 31st.
Click here to see a listing of current volunteer opportunities. In order to become a volunteer you must:
1) Be at least 16 years of age
2) Complete a Volunteer application
3) Pass the required background check
You will be notified once your background check is cleared and will then be scheduled for a club orientation before officially becoming a volunteer.
* We understand that some high schools require students to complete a minimum number of community service hours for graduation. We do offer some limited volunteer opportunities for students who are interested in performing their service with Boys & Girls Clubs of Metro Atlanta.
